    The Science Behind the Magic

    Dry ice, also known as solid carbon dioxide, is the solid form of carbon dioxide gas. At a temperature of -109.3°F (-78.5°C), carbon dioxide gas condenses into a snow-like substance. When compressed, this snow transforms into dry ice, which has a temperature of -109.3°F (-78.5°C) and a density of 1.56 g/cm³.

    Safety First

    While dry ice offers a world of possibilities, it is essential to handle it with care. Its extreme cold can cause frostbite, so always wear gloves when handling it. Never ingest dry ice, as it can cause severe internal injuries.
